Ankündigung

Einklappen
Keine Ankündigung bisher.

Synchronisation von Labeln / Cursorn

Einklappen
X
 
  • Filter
  • Zeit
  • Anzeigen
Alles löschen
neue Beiträge

    #16
    Danke, dass du Dir die Mühe gemacht hast das auseinanderzudividieren.

    Kommentar


      #17
      Hallo wvhn,

      Ich habe es leseseitig probiert, wieder mit der Brechstange, geht aber auch:

      Erstmal nur für default (avg):
      Aus Zeile 1085:
      Code:
      'avg': 'MIN(time), ' + self._precision_query('AVG(val_num * duration) / AVG(duration)'),
      wird
      Code:
      'avg': 'MIN(ROUND(time/10000)*10000), ' + self._precision_query('AVG(val_num * duration) / AVG(duration)'),
      Das rundet jetzt auch SQL seitig. Diesen Rundungsfaktor könnte man jetzt konfigufierbar machen. Eine Art Distinct wäre bestimmt noch hilfreich. Mal sehen, was aschwith dazu sagt.

      Gruß
      curator17

      Kommentar


        #18
        Hallo curator17,

        aus meiner Sicht war die Auflösung der Zeitstempel für die DB Einträge auch etwas übertrieben. Ich bin mir aber nicht sicher, ob es hier User gibt, die diese Genauigkeit irgendwie benötigen. Den Rundungsfaktor konfigurierbar zu machen, finde ich daher gut. Gerne analog zu dem schon vorhandenen Plugin Parameter "precisin", der die Roundung der ausgelesenen DB Werte konfiguriert. Gerne einen PR erstellen.

        Viele Grüße
        Alex

        Kommentar


          #19
          Hallo curator17, aschwith,

          wurde der Pull Request auf github für die vorgeschlagene Änderung erstellt? Es wäre schade, wenn diese gute Lösung wieder verschwinden würde.

          Gruß
          Wolfram

          Kommentar


            #20
            Hallo wvhn, aschwith,

            könnt ihr mal drüber schauen. Ich habe nur einen Smoke Test gemacht, der war erfolgreich:
            https://github.com/smarthomeNG/plugins/pull/974
            image.png
            (die waren bei mir ohne Fix im ms Bereich versetzt)

            Da ich an der Stelle ja eh grad dran war, habe ich gedacht probier ich mal zu unterstützen

            Kommentar


              #21
              aldaris ,

              Das sieht für mich gut aus.
              aschwith als Maintainer des Plugins sollte aber nochmal draufschauen und den PR dann mergen, wenn er einverstanden ist.

              Danke und Gruß
              Wolfram

              Kommentar


                #22
                Bin noch nicht dazu gekommen, schaue es mir aber in den nächsten Tagen an.

                Kommentar

                Lädt...
                X